The Opportunity:

Join the CACI team dedicated to advancing national security through innovative irregular warfare and operations expertise. CACI is hiring Return on Investment (ROI) Specialists on a program that delivers mission-critical advisory training and operational support services that help mission partners stay ahead of rapidly evolving global threats. This role is responsible for cost-benefit analysis producing readiness metrics and analyzing and evaluating financial and strategic returns while applying provide ROI methodologies to ensure that every resource delivers measurable mission-aligned results.

This is an opportunity to contribute to high-impact missions collaborate with experienced professionals and support strategic operations that strengthen our nations defense capabilities around the world. Candidates who thrive in dynamic environments embrace complex challenges and are committed to mission excellence will find meaningful opportunities for growth and impact within CACI and on this team.

These positions are contingent upon award of the contract and will be located in Tampa FL and Fayetteville NC.


Responsibilities:

  • Evaluates the financial strategic and mission-capability returns on major defense investments

  • Ensure that resources deliver optimal readiness and economic value

  • Calculating the financial costs of programs against non-financial or mission-related benefits

  • Assessing how investments improve operations Acquisition Reform: Utilizing private-sector financial practices to minimize total lifecycle costs in defense acquisitions

  • Routinely utilizes ROI Methodology to perform strategic analysis


Qualifications:
Required:

  • 5 years of corporate-level statistics experience

  • Active TS-SCI security clearance

  • Bachelors degree in business administration or related field


Desired:

  • Active PMP certification
